A simple question regarding MIG torches, MIG spoolguns, TIG torches, etc.

How interchangeable are they? Not MIG to TIG, but using a Lincoln TIG torch on a Miller machine, or a Tweco torch on an ESAB, etc? :willy_nil

Or is this one of those ******** proprietary areas? :headscrat

Each machine manufacturer uses a different power pin, which is the brass piece on the end of the gun that plugs into the welder. On some guns you can change the power pin but others you can't.

Depends on the machine and the torch.

Sometimes the 'torch' is the same and just the connectors to the machine change (via 'adapters').

Sometimes the connectors are 'hard wired' as part of the torch/cable assembly.

Sometimes the 'same' torch can be had from different companies (sometimes with the same part number, and sometimes with different part numbers).
